remote
Data Analyst SQL & Python - legalandgeneral
Data Analyst
Data Analyst role focused on extracting, transforming, and visualising financial data using SQL and Python to support strategic decision‑making in a leading financial services group.
About the role
Key Responsibilities
- Design, develop and maintain complex SQL queries and Python scripts to extract, cleanse and transform large datasets from multiple sources.
- Build and optimise data pipelines and ETL processes to ensure accurate, timely data delivery for reporting and analytics.
- Create interactive dashboards and visualisations using tools such as Power BI or Tableau to communicate insights to stakeholders.
- Collaborate with cross‑functional teams to define data requirements, validate data quality and support ad‑hoc analytical requests.
- Document data models, processes and best practices to enable knowledge sharing and maintainability.
Requirements
- Proven experience with SQL (T‑SQL, PL/SQL) and Python (pandas, NumPy, matplotlib/seaborn).
- Strong analytical mindset with the ability to translate business questions into data solutions.
- Experience building dashboards and visualisations in Power BI, Tableau or similar.
- Familiarity with ETL concepts and data warehousing principles.
- Excellent communication skills and a collaborative approach to problem solving.
Skills
sqlpythondata analysis